Traders in Syria should prioritize brokers that offer strong regulatory oversight, transparent and competitive fees, and reliable access to local or widely usable payment methods. Key considerations include the safety of client funds, clear pricing on spreads, commissions, and withdrawals, as well as account funding and payout options that work smoothly from Syria. With 190+ brokers available, comparing these factors helps narrow the field to platforms that match your trading goals and operational needs.
BrokerRank ranks brokers for Syria traders using a structured methodology that evaluates regulation and trust signals, total trading costs, platform quality, instrument range, execution and reliability, and customer support. We also factor in practical accessibility for Syria-based users, including account onboarding, available payment methods, and the consistency of service. This approach is designed to provide an objective, Syria-relevant shortlist of brokers suitable for different experience levels and trading styles.
Our rankings use a weighted algorithm covering regulation (25%), fees (20%), platform quality (15%), market variety (10%), trust/longevity (15%), and user experience (15%). Scores are recalculated every 24 hours.
